WindWings Rigid Wing Sail System

Revolutionary Wind-Assisted Propulsion Technology

The WindWings rigid wing sail is a groundbreaking wind-assisted propulsion system that can reduce fuel consumption by 20-30% on suitable routes.


How It Works

  • Automated wing adjustment based on wind conditions
  • Retractable design for port operations and low bridges
  • Integrated sensors optimize thrust coefficient continuously
  • Zero crew intervention during normal operation

Environmental Impact

  1. CO2 reduction: Up to 3,000 tonnes per vessel annually
  2. Fuel savings: 1,500+ tonnes HFO equivalent per year
  3. CII improvement: 1-2 rating band improvement achievable
Developed with $50 million in R&D investment, WindWings represents the future of sustainable shipping - already operational on the world's largest car carrier.
